bliss515 Posted October 13, 2010 Share Posted October 13, 2010 Any updates? I have a 2011 fusion sport w/ the 12 speaker sony system and having the same FM sound fluctuation. So after having it at the dealer 3 times, they replaces some module twice.... It did make the sound a little better, but the sound continues to fade in and out (Treble) After the dealership contacted ford engineers, their response was something like this......... "When a radio signal is not very stong the treble is the first thing to go" so basically they blew me off and are blaming it on poor signal strength..... Nordb3rg Posted December 14, 2010 Share Posted December 14, 2010 I purchased a 2010 SE Fusion with the 6 speaker system and SYNC and I am having the same issue where the treble disappears periodically and the sound becomes muffled. I traded my 03 Corrolla CE with 4 speaker single disc stereo for the Fusion and never had an issue with FM reception the 8years I owned it. I drive the same roads twice a day for work and I experience this issue between 5-10 times each time. The dealer replaced the entire radio which included an FM module. The replacement was unsuccessful. I am still experiencing the disappearing treble and muffled sound. I have an appointment next week with the dealer to attempt to demonstrate the issue with them, basically a ride-along. This is the very first Ford product I have ever owned and, although fluctuating FM reception may seem like a minor issue, I will always have a little regret for this purchase until the issue is resolved.
